Tal Amiran

Tal Amiran is a multi-award winning documentary filmmaker and editor based in London. His first short documentary Seven Days a Week (2016) was screened at 27 festivals and won 7 awards, and his second short documentary Sand Men (2017) was screened at 41 festivals and won 10 awards. His latest work, Dafa Metti (Mountainfilm 2020) tells the story of Senegalese immigrants who sell Eiffel Tower souvenirs in order to survive in Paris. Amiran is a lecturer at Norwich University of the Arts.
